NEW YORK CITY â âTim Rowan: New Workâ will be on view April 12âMay 12 at Cavin-Morris Gallery.
A clay vessel holds more than internal or external space. There are artists all over the world whose bodies of work hold within them a phenomenon that is a combination of not only a place but history as well. Tim Rowanâs sculptures capture time and place.
Rowanâs work dances on that high wire where utilitarian coincidences and non-utilitarian choices taunt each other endlessly. His spiked vessels are examples of this; holding a tea bowl form they are almost unusable because they will pierce the lip that is put to them thus deconstructing and subverting the traditional intentionality of the tea vessel. And yet their forms still cut eye-pleasing silhouettes in space.
His larger sculptures play with the same sense of familiarity and subterfuge. They hold references but they are not tied to dogma, they are always shifting in their patterns of meaning from the way earth holds stones in rain, snow and blistering heat to industrial noise and rough perfection.
